无盘系统 Linux:深入探索无状态计算136

引言

无盘系统是一种特殊的操作系统配置,其中所有文件和应用程序都存储在中央服务器上,而不是本地磁盘驱动器上。当客户端计算机启动时,它们会从服务器加载操作系统和应用,然后在不使用本地存储的情况下运行。无盘系统 Linux 是一个特别流行的选择,因为它提供了许多优点,包括增强安全性、提高效率和降低成本。

工作原理

无盘系统 Linux 依赖于网络引导协议(NetBoot),它允许计算机从远程服务器启动。当客户端启动时,会通过网络向服务器发送请求。服务器会响应并提供一个引导映像,客户端会使用该映像加载操作系统。一旦操作系统加载完毕,客户端会从服务器加载必要的应用程序和文件。

优点

无盘系统 Linux 具有许多显著优点,包括:

增强安全性:由于所有数据都存储在中央服务器上,因此几乎不可能物理窃取或破坏数据。这使得无盘系统 Linux 对于处理敏感信息的组织来说非常适合。提高效率:通过消除对本地存储的需求,无盘系统 Linux 可以简化客户端管理并减少故障点。这可以节省大量时间和资源。降低成本:无盘系统 Linux 可以通过消除对昂贵本地存储的需求来降低硬件成本。此外,集中式管理可以降低维护和支持费用。快速部署:由于所有数据和应用程序都存储在中央位置,因此在客户端计算机上部署新软件或更新非常容易。这可以节省大量时间和精力。

缺点

尽管有许多优点,但无盘系统 Linux 也有几个潜在的缺点,包括:

对网络依赖:无盘系统 Linux 严重依赖于网络连接。如果网络出现故障,客户端将无法启动或运行应用程序。性能限制:由于数据和应用程序需要从服务器加载,因此无盘系统 Linux 的性能可能低于使用本地存储的操作系统。存储空间限制:服务器上的存储空间有限,因此可能需要定期清理旧数据和应用程序,以腾出空间。

适用于无盘系统 Linux 的发行版

有许多 Linux 发行版可以用于创建无盘系统。最流行的包括:

PXE Linux:一种轻量级发行版,专为网络引导而设计。Ubuntu无盘:基于 Ubuntu 操作系统的无盘发行版,提供广泛的软件支持。CentOS无盘:基于 CentOS 的发行版,非常适合企业环境。Tiny Core Linux:一种超轻量级发行版,非常适合资源受限的设备。Damn Small Linux:另一种轻量级发行版,具有基本的图形界面和应用程序。

结论

无盘系统 Linux 是一个强大的操作系统配置,提供了许多优势,包括增强安全性、提高效率和降低成本。但是,在实施无盘系统 Linux 之前,必须仔细考虑其潜在的缺点,例如对网络的依赖性和性能限制。通过选择合适的 Linux 发行版并仔细规划,组织可以有效利用无盘系统 Linux 的好处,同时最大限度地减少其风险。

2024-10-28


上一篇:Android 系统架构:深入解析

下一篇:华为何时能够全面使用鸿蒙操作系统?